It was January 11, 1970, when the Kansas City Chiefs last went to and won a Super Bowl. Former Chiefs linebacker Willie Lanier recently reminisced over the anniversary of that event with then-placekicker Jan Stenerud, whose field goal that day set up a 3-0 lead that the team never lost.
